Just giving quick and easy tips to make your Mexican food more of a kick.
>Use Habaneros in your Mexican dishes. Add them in salsas, ceviches, and add them in cochinita pibil
>Use a bit of pilloncillo whenever you make something with tomatillos to balance the tartness. An example would be costilla en chile verde (pork ribs in a green sauce).
>buy Mexican herbs at all costs. do not substitute epazote, hierba santa, avocado leaves etc etc
>Use "masa" in your stews and soups. This give it a nice consistency and a nice flavor
>start making tostadas instead of tacos. Tostadas are damn great and can be made with anything from beans to raw tuna.
>Guacamole can be made in various ways. yes, avocado +lime +tomato+jalapeno is great, but there are other ways of doing it such as adding pomegranate
